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

SqlConnection.Close () bên trong câu lệnh using

Không cần phải Close or Dispose using khối sẽ chăm sóc điều đó cho bạn.

Như đã nêu từ MSDN:

Ví dụ sau tạo một SqlConnection, mở nó, hiển thị một số thuộc tính của nó. Kết nối sẽ tự động đóng ở cuối khối đang sử dụng.

private static void OpenSqlConnection(string connectionString) 
{
    using (SqlConnection connection = new SqlConnection(connectionString))
    {
        connection.Open();
        Console.WriteLine("ServerVersion: {0}", connection.ServerVersion);
        Console.WriteLine("State: {0}", connection.State);
    } 
}


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Thêm cột bảng mới vào vị trí thứ tự cụ thể trong Microsoft SQL Server

  2. SQL Server sử dụng CPU cao khi tìm kiếm bên trong chuỗi nvarchar

  3. Giải thích về ANSI_NULLS của Máy chủ SQL

  4. SQL:mệnh đề in trong thủ tục được lưu trữ:cách chuyển giá trị

  5. Tại sao (và cách) chia cột bằng cách sử dụng master..spt_values?